Learning to forgive isn’t always easy.
But it’s always good for you.
❤️ It’s good for your health. It can help lower the risk of heart attacks, improve your sleep, and reduce levels of anxiety, depression, and stress.
🧠 It helps you move forward. When you forgive, you let go of resentment and can heal without the anger.
And more importantly…
📖 It’s taught in the Bible. There are many verses and stories in the Bible that teach the importance of learning how to forgive, what real forgiveness looks like, and why we need forgiveness.
So if you’ve been holding a grudge all year long, or there’s someone you’ve been meaning to say “sorry” to but haven’t gotten around to it…today is the day to try it.
As Daniel, the writer of the “How I Learned to Forgive” blog, says, “Forgiveness is a process. At first, it can be hard. Like, really hard. But it gets easier every time you do it. Forgiveness requires humility when you ask for it, and kindness when you give it, and every step must be earned and made in good faith. God forgives, and He shouldn’t expect any less of us.”

Talking to the Dead
Many people feel the need to show their love and respect for the departed even online. They change their profile pictures with lit candles on a black background. They even talk to them; telling them about their regrets and broken promises.
True Christians do not talk or pray for their dead because it is not taught by the Bible. Some people find relief in thinking that they are doing their dead loved ones some favor by praying for them, but it's actually a pointless practice. This is so because the Bible says:
"....the dead know nothing" and "They will never again take part in anything that happens in this world." (Eccl. 9:5-6, New King James Version). Clearly, talking to and praying for the welfare of the dead is in vain. There is nothing that the living can do that will benefit the dead.
They can't hear us. They can't see us. They won't benefit from us. What's worst is that such practices are branded by the Bible as "an abomination to the Lord" (Deuteronomy 18:10-13).
Yes, we feel sad when someone passes away. We miss them. We even cry when we remember the good old days with them. But we don't pray for them and we don't talk to them (even online); because such practices are against the teachings of God.
